Mongolia is an amazing country tucked away in East Asia being the one of the best for the tourists all over the world. It's known for its wide-open plains, the cool traditions of its nomadic people, and its connection to the legendary Genghis Khan. Even though not many people live but many people tend traveling there, Mongolia has some of the most beautiful untouched nature you can imagine: deserts, mountains, and grassy plains. Ulaanbaatar, the capital city, is a mix of modern life and old customs.
Some must-see places to travel along the country are like:
* The Gobi Desert: A huge, dry area with sand dunes, special animals, and lots of fossils.
* Karakorum: The ancient capital of the Mongol Empire, where you can see the Erdene Zuu Monastery.
* Lake Khövsgöl: One of the biggest freshwater lakes in the world, located in the north.
* Terelj National Park: Famous for its incredible rock formations and fun outdoor activities.
And don't forget the Genghis Khan Statue Complex to get the tour for, which has the largest statue of a person on horseback anywhere! If you like adventure and beautiful scenery, Mongolia is definitely worth visiting. You can experience traditional life in yurts (called "gers" here), explore ancient ruins, and hike through stunning landscapes.
